The complete question is;

Shield laws protect journalists' right to refuse to testify against their sources while gathering information in their role as journalists. There is no shield law at the federal level.

Which of the following statements is best supported by the information on the map?

A-Some states are more interested in cooperating with the federal government than others are.

B-Some states prioritize freedom of the press over criminal prosecutions.

C-Some states receive more federal funding for shield law programs than other states do.

D-Some states adhere to the exclusionary rule of the First Amendment more than other states do.

Answer:

B). Some states prioritize freedom of the press over criminal prosecutions.

Explanation:

The second statement most adequately backs the information provided on the map that 'certain states give more importance and priority to the press' freedom than to the criminal proceedings.' <u>The description regarding the shield laws proffering the Journalists' with an authority to not reveal the sources they have used to gather specific information displays the significance of media's freedom but it also signals that sometimes this right overpowers the criminal proceedings by hiding the sources that may reveal the truth by providing important evidence or clue to identify the gulity</u>. Thus, <u>option B</u> is the correct answer.

When using judicial restraint, a judge will usually ________.
julia-pushkina [17]

Answer:

When using judicial restraint, a judge will usually defer to the decisions of the elected branches of government.

Explanation:

The theory by which the powers of the judges are restricted and limited to strike down the laws is said to be judicial restraint. Judicial activism is the opposite of judicial restraint. The unconstitutional laws are subjected to be stroked down by the judges. The judicial restraint curtails the power of the judges unless the laws are unconstitutional.
